- borrarse► verbo pronominal1 to disappear* * *VPR1) (=darse de baja)
borrarse de — [+ club, asociación] to cancel one's membership of, resign from; [+ curso] to drop out of
se borró de la biblioteca — she cancelled her library membership
siempre hay alguien que se borra del curso al principio — there's always somebody who drops out of the course at the beginning
2) (=desaparecer) [señal, marca] to fade away; [imagen, recuerdo] to fade; [duda, sospecha, temor] to disappear, be dispelled; [sonrisa] to vanishse había borrado el código — the code number had faded away
eso se borra con agua — that comes off o washes off with water
lo que pasó aquel día se me ha borrado con el tiempo — the memory of what happened that day has faded with time
no se han borrado las sospechas entre la pareja — the suspicion between the two of them has not disappeared o been dispelled
3) (Fot) to fade* * *
